Abstract

Conducting online quizzes and examinations have been done for several years in many ways. However, it became popular and unavoidable during this covid-19 pandemic. There are many types of solutions which are available predominantly in the web pages. Thorough study was carried out to enhance the prevailing methods with better security and performance. In existing online exam there are many ways to identify the malpractice, hence it is vital to develop an effective face detection algorithm to avoid malpractice. However, detecting faces continuously throughout the exam from the candidate is still challenging and memory consuming. In this paper, a computer vision algorithm named Haarcascade classification has been proposed for robust and continuous face detection for conducting proctor exams. One of the main malpractices is using the Virtual machines during the online exams. This work also focuses over an algorithm to detect the malpractice which has been done with the help of External or s Third-Party Virtual Machines. In future, a secured application can be developed for uploading the random questions for the respective organization to conduct Online Examinations.
